Least Common Multiple of 90386 and 90399 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 90386 and 90399, than apply into the LCM equation.

GCF(90386,90399) = 1
LCM(90386,90399) = ( 90386 × 90399) / 1
LCM(90386,90399) = 8170804014 / 1
LCM(90386,90399) = 8170804014
